Abstract

The utility model discloses a textile fabric dust removal device which comprises an operation box, wherein the operation box is divided into three working chambers by a partition plate, through grooves are formed in the partition plate, the working chambers are respectively a vibrating chamber, a dust removal chamber and a wrinkle removal chamber from right to left, vibrating rods are arranged in the vibrating chambers, two groups of dust collection devices are arranged in the dust removal chambers, two electric heating ironing plates are arranged in the wrinkle removal chambers, impurities in air are filtered through the arranged vibrating rods, the dust collection devices, an air inlet, the electric heating ironing plates and the like, secondary pollution is prevented, slight deformation of textile fabric due to adsorption is removed, and wrinkles are prevented.

Description

Textile fabric dust removal device
Technical Field
The utility model belongs to the technical field of spinning, and particularly relates to a dust removing device for textile fabrics.
Background
After current textile fabric production is accomplished, the surface often can adsorb debris such as dust, garrulous batting, current textile fabric coiling mechanism adopts the dust absorption head of great suction to aim at textile fabric and adsorb dust removal work more, but there are debris such as dust, garrulous batting in the textile mill's the air, debris in the air can be owing to the adsorption of dust absorption head, the opposite side on being adsorbed textile fabric, lead to dust removal effect not good, and the adsorption can lead to textile fabric to produce inhomogeneous deformation, and then produce the fold, the quality of finished product has been influenced.
Disclosure of Invention
Aiming at the technical defects that the prior textile fabric dust removing device cannot avoid secondary adsorption of dust, broken flock and other impurities in the air on the textile fabric and wrinkles generated in the dust removing process, the utility model provides a textile fabric dust removing device so as to filter the impurities in the air, prevent secondary pollution and remove wrinkles and smooth the effect.
To achieve the above object, the present utility model proposes the following techniques: the utility model provides a textile fabric dust collector, includes the operation box, be equipped with the support under the operation box, the operation box is separated by the baffle and is three working chamber, be equipped with logical groove on the baffle, the working chamber is vibration room, clean room and wrinkle removal room respectively from right to left.
The right side of the vibrating chamber is provided with a feed inlet, the vibrating chamber is provided with an upper rotating roller and a lower rotating roller, the rotating rollers are rotatably connected to the front inner wall and the rear inner wall of the vibrating chamber through bearings, and a vibrating rod is arranged between the rotating rollers.
The dust removal chamber is provided with two groups of dust collection devices, the dust collection devices are respectively arranged on the upper wall and the lower wall of the dust removal chamber, the front end of each dust collection device is provided with an arc dust collection head, an air inlet is formed corresponding to each arc dust collection head, and the front section of each air inlet is provided with a concave arc filter plate.
The left side in the dust removal chamber is equipped with the live-rollers, the live-rollers pass through the bearing and rotate to be connected in the inner wall around the dust removal chamber.
Two electric heating ironing plates are arranged in the wrinkle-removing chamber, and a discharge hole is arranged at the left side of the wrinkle-removing chamber.
Compared with the prior art, the comprehensive effects brought by the utility model comprise:
according to the utility model, through the structures such as the vibrating rod, the dust collection device, the air inlet, the electric heating ironing plate and the like, impurities in air are filtered, secondary pollution is prevented, slight deformation of textile cloth due to adsorption is removed, and wrinkles are prevented.

Detailed Description
The technical solutions in the embodiments of the present utility model will be clearly and completely described below with reference to the drawings in the embodiments of the present utility model, but the embodiments of the present utility model are not limited thereto.
In this document, appearances of such terms as "upper", "lower", "left", "right", etc., in the directions or positional relationships indicated are based on the directions or positional relationships shown in the drawings, are merely for convenience of description and to simplify the description, and do not indicate or imply that the devices or elements referred to must have a specific orientation, be constructed and operated in a specific orientation, and thus should not be construed as limiting the utility model.
As shown in fig. 1, a dust removing device for textile fabrics comprises an operation box 1, wherein the operation box 1 is divided into three working chambers by a partition board 101, the partition board 101 is provided with a through groove 1011, the working chambers are respectively a vibrating chamber 3, a dust removing chamber 4 and a wrinkle removing chamber 5 from right to left, and the working chambers are separated by the partition board 101 to prevent the working contents of the three working chambers from affecting each other.
The right side of the vibrating chamber 3 is provided with a feeding hole 301, the vibrating chamber 3 is provided with an upper rotating roller 6 and a lower rotating roller 6, the rotating rollers 6 are rotationally connected to the front inner wall and the rear inner wall of the vibrating chamber 3 through bearings, a vibrating rod 7 is arranged between the two rotating rollers 6, and dust on textile cloth is vibrated loosely through high-frequency vibration by the vibrating rod 7, so that the dust collection work in the next step is more efficient.
The dust removal chamber 4 is equipped with two sets of dust extraction 8, dust extraction 8 locates dust removal chamber 4 upper wall and lower wall respectively, dust extraction 8 front end is equipped with circular arc dust absorption head 801, corresponds with circular arc dust absorption head 801 and is equipped with air inlet 9, air inlet 9 leads to outside the device, the air inlet 9 anterior segment is equipped with concave arc type filter 901, impurity in the concave arc type filter 901 can the filtered air, concave arc type filter 901 can wrap circular arc dust absorption head 801, makes circular arc dust absorption head 801 inspiratory air all have passed through concave arc type filter 901's filtration, makes the textile fabric can not by secondary pollution, and two sets of dust extraction 8 act on the both sides of textile fabric respectively, makes the dust removal more complete.
The left side is equipped with rotor 6 in the dust removal room 4, rotor 6 passes through the bearing rotation and connects in the inner wall around the dust removal room 4 for the motion trail of location textile fabric.
The support 2 is arranged below the operation box 1, and the operation box 1 is supported by the support 2, so that air inlet 9 is convenient to enter.
Two electric heating ironing plates 10 are arranged in the wrinkle removing chamber 5, the electric heating ironing plates 10 deform the textile cloth unevenly due to adsorption to generate wrinkles and iron, and a discharge hole 501 is arranged on the left side of the wrinkle removing chamber 5.
The working principle of the embodiment of the utility model is as follows: when the dust removing device for the textile fabric is used, the dust removing device for the textile fabric is placed on a production line, the textile fabric is placed at the position shown in fig. 1, the textile fabric moves from right to left by traction on the production line, the textile fabric enters the vibration chamber 3 from the feed inlet 301, dust on the textile fabric is vibrated and floated on the surface by high-frequency vibration of the vibration rod 7, the next dust collection work is more efficient, the textile fabric enters the dust removing chamber 4, the concave arc filter plate 901 filters dust and broken cotton fibers in the air, the upper surface and the lower surface of the textile fabric are respectively removed by matching of the two groups of arc dust collection heads 801 and the concave arc filter plate 901, the dust removing effect is better, the textile fabric enters the wrinkle removing chamber 5, the electric heating ironing plate 10 generates uneven deformation on the textile fabric caused by dust collection work, the generated wrinkles are ironed, the textile fabric comes out from the discharge outlet 501 and enters the next working procedure of the production line.
